CARBO Ceramics Reports Improved Revenues and Income


CARBO Ceramics Inc (Irving, TX, USA) - the manufacturer of ceramic proppants for use in the hydraulic fracturing of natural gas and oil wells, has reported net income of US$6.3 million on revenues of US$31.1 million for the quarter ended 31 December 2001. This compares with net income of US$4.2 million on revenues of US$24 million for the fourth quarter of 2000.

President and CEO Mark Pearson commented: "We are encouraged by the strength of our North American sales despite the continuing decline in natural gas drilling activity. We believe this demonstrates the success of our marketing program that promotes the economic benefit of using ceramic proppant in shallower wells. While we expect to be operating in a difficult market environment in the first half of 2002, we will continue to move forward with plans to increase manufacturing and distribution capacity based on our long-term outlook.

"The construction of our manufacturing facility in China is progressing within the established budget and on schedule. We continue to expect that the plant will be complete and operational by the end of 2002. In 2002, we also plan to increase research and development activities targeted at new product development in both oilfield and industrial applications."
